Many grocery chains target in-stock rates of 90 percent for individual stores so that sufficient substitutes exist for a customer to purchase a substitute item rather than go to a competing store.
Managerial Perceptions
The individual beliefs or understanding held by managers regarding various aspects of their organization, environment, or team, which can influence decision-making.
Financial Measures
Quantitative indicators used to assess the financial health and performance of a business or organization.
Leading Indicator
A measurable economic factor that changes before the economy starts to follow a particular pattern or trend, used to anticipate changes.
HRM Evaluation
The process of examining and assessing the effectiveness of Human Resource Management practices and policies in achieving organizational goals.
